Facilities ticket — Night shift, Brindlecote Campus. Twenty-two interns from the Fennhollow programme arrive tomorrow at 08:00. Please unlock seminar rooms B2 and B3 by 06:30, set chairs to classroom layout, and confirm the water coolers on level one are refilled. Leave the loading bay clear for their equipment van. Overnight access to the prep corridor requires the pass code below.

badge for bajop-yawep: bdg-NNHEW-6

## v3.2.0 — Changed Defaults

Duskrunner, the nightly backfill scheduler, now defaults to staggered window starts instead of a fixed kickoff. Plugin authors relying on the old simultaneous-start behavior should declare an explicit window in their manifest. Retry backoff also moved from linear to exponential by default. The new default configuration shipped with this release is shown below.

settings of fafog-haduf:
ZORIX_PIN=4648
ZORIX_METRICS_HOST=metrics.zorix.paliqsys.corp
ZORIX_LOG_LEVEL=info
ZORIX_TENANT=druix

## Configuration

Gatefold, the internal API gateway, enforces per-client rate limits via `GATEFOLD_RATE_WINDOW` and `GATEFOLD_RATE_MAX`. Limits are evaluated in-memory per node, so multiply by replica count when reasoning about totals. Overrides for priority clients live in the limits table. The gateway authenticates to that limits store with a shared secret, defined on the following line.

sealed setting: VAULT_KEY5=0924b